Desktop IPTV and VoD solution for Windows platform

Situation
Our client, a leader in IPTV hardware for the corporate and hospitality markets, required a solution for viewing IPTV broadcasts and Video on Demand streams on the desktop. Client identified two discrete customer segments, one where a solution designed as a bespoke application was preferable and a second where deployment of a bespoke software application was a stumbling block

Solution
Using our IP portfolio we successfully addressed both segments for the customer.

  • IPTV/VoD PVR application - Codevio consulted on and then developed a bespoke Windows application to receive digital TV and radio channels streamed over a network, allowing the user to view them, record them to the hard drive for later viewing and pause live television. This solution was delivered to the customer in a very short time-frame by combining some of our existing IP with a full IPTV and VoD (RTSP) stack designed to their requirements
     
  • IPTV/VoD plugin for Windows Media Player - in consultation with the customer we came up with an innovative solution for corporate environments where the deployment of bespoke application was not an option. The solution used our inside knowledge of the workings of the Windows Media Player product line and Microsoft's DirectShow API to deliver a solution which could be deployed as a single DLL integrating seamlessly into Media Player and embedded into web pages.

Software integration for embedded H.264/VC-1 HW decoder

Situation
The customer required support for their PCI Express hardware video decoder card added to a popular Linux/Windows open source media player VideoLan (VLC).

Solution
Codevio's engineers used their experience in the digital media space to turn this project around within a man month. Customer's existing investment in driver/user mode software for the Windows platform was utilised to reduce the engineering effort required to a minimum.

Application development for PC TV Tuner Card Manfacturer

Situation
Our client, a leading developer of digital TV products, had developed a new PCMCIA tuner card specifically for laptops, and needed a comprehensive software application to bundle with the product.

Solution 
Codevio created a TV viewing and recording application from existing resources, ensuring full compatibility with the new card. Codevio also sourced, reviewed and tested a number of MPEG-2 codecs to use with the application, advising the client on the pros and cons of each codec. The chosen codec was integrated into a newly formed installer, giving the client a simple to install application, to provide with their new TV tuner card. Codevio also provided expertise, testing and debugging support to client's driver development team in the Windows BDA driver architecture

Development of Windows Media Centre showcase for AMD products

Situation
AMD, a top tier vendor in the PC processor business, required online marketing materials to showcase their AMD 'Live' brand, a new product line aimed at users of PCs running Windows Media Center. The client required a '10ft' version of their existing website that could integrate seamlessly with Windows Media Center, but did not have the relevant experience or resource to complete the new website in time for the very short deadline.

Solution
By using our experience of 10ft UI design and our expertise with PC based Media Center applications Codevio were able to create the showcase product to the clients specification within the deadline.
